Gallot emphasizes the shift in developer maturity regarding Proof Of Concept (POC) projects, noting that they are increasingly successful. The initial approach involved numerous scattered scenarios without a clear framework, leading to failures in execution. Now, developers are gaining the ability to filter and prioritize their scenarios effectively, resulting in POCs becoming viable and leading to more substantive outcomes. While AI assistants are advancing, Gallot believes they won't completely displace developers, as understanding business cases remains crucial.
"I think we're seeing much more successful POCs because people got much more mature about picking the scenarios they go after."
"Fast-forward two years later, people are much more capable of, first of all, understanding what questions they need to clean up, and filter out, and triage all the scenarios they're going after."
